If you are a talented and enthusiastic mechanical engineer, interested in working on a range of novel, bespoke and prototype vehicles, we would like to hear from you. Performance Projects Ltd has for over a decade undertaken an amazing range of projects, from Formula 1 to vintage race cars, electric bicycles to autonomous tractors.
The great projects keep coming in, and we need to bolster our mechanical design team. Between us there will be a blend of talents and experiences. One of the team members we are after will be a lead engineer, who in addition to design work will assist the principle engineer in the day to day management of projects.
For the lead design engineer:
- A mechanical engineer with a sound understanding of engineering principles, likely to have a good degree in engineering. Knowledgeable on vehicle layouts and design, experience in race or production car design required.
- Very capable using Catia or Solidworks for solid and engineering surface design (no requirement for A Class free-form surfacing skills).
- Comfortable and effective with the day to day oversight of a team of mechanical design engineers. This would include prioritising and assigning tasks, liaising with manufacturers, keeping track of progress, design checking.
- Working with the principle engineer, who will provide guidance and advice when needed.
For all design engineers:
- A mechanical engineer with a sound understanding of mechanical engineering design. Knowledgeable on vehicle layouts and design, design of metallic components, experience in very low volume car design (race or niche road car) is likely but not essential.
- A keen interest in working on a diverse portfolio, from small autonomous platforms & electric drivelines through to high performance niche automotive design.
- Capable using Catia or Solidworks for solid and engineering surface design (no requirement for A Class free-form surfacing skills).
- Working with the principle engineer and lead design engineer, who will provide guidance and expert knowledge as required.
- Successful candidates will range from relatively inexperienced to those who are very experienced but are not drawn to a role involving management.
Amongst the team will be someone who is proficient with FEA, someone who is keen to maintain the CAD/PDM systems, and someone who is experienced with kinematics analysis in CAD.
Remote working will be possible when appropriate. Everyone will be together at least one day per week minimum on site at Silverstone, along with potential requirement for short project periods at client locations. During vehicle build it is likely being on site 5 days per week may be required.
Pay will be competitive, and will depend on ability aligned with the projects. Both contract and permanent staff are being sought.
